KPI Green Energy (542323) Q1 26/27 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q1 26/27 earnings summary
12 Aug, 2026Executive summary
Q1 FY27 revenue grew 16% YoY to ₹710 crore, with EBITDA up 21% to ₹262 crore, driven by robust execution and portfolio expansion across IPP and CPP segments; PAT declined 14% YoY to ₹95 crore due to higher depreciation and finance costs from rapid asset base growth.
Portfolio reached 6.94 GW (up 71% YoY), with 1.87 GW installed and 5.07 GW under execution, targeting 10+ GW by 2030.
Expanded into new geographies including Rajasthan, Botswana (5 GW MOU, 500 MW phase underway), UAE (solar+BESS for data centers), and Maharashtra EPC markets.
Major project milestones included commissioning of 200 MW solar for Coal India, new BESS agreements, and significant order wins in battery storage and floating solar.
Leadership strengthened with new Vice-Chairman, Whole-time Director, and incoming CFO; MSKC & Associates LLP appointed as new statutory auditors.
Financial highlights
Q1 FY27 total income: ₹710 crore vs ₹614 crore in Q1 FY26 (16% YoY growth); EBITDA: ₹262 crore vs ₹217 crore YoY (21% growth); EBITDA margin improved to 37% from 35%.
PAT: ₹95 crore vs ₹111 crore YoY, reflecting higher depreciation and finance costs; PAT margin at 13% in Q1 FY27, down from 18% YoY.
Cash profit: ₹173 crore vs ₹163 crore YoY (6% growth); cash profit margin slightly decreased to 24% from 27%.
Interest costs rose 111% and depreciation 70% YoY, reflecting asset base expansion.
Sun Drops subsidiary Q1 revenue: ₹154.55 crore, PAT: ₹26 crore, EBITDA: ₹42 crore.
Outlook and guidance
Expect stronger performance in upcoming quarters as new assets stabilize and contribute fully; full earnings contribution from new assets expected during the year.
FY27 revenue growth guidance maintained at 30%-40% YoY, with potential for higher if geopolitical conditions improve; targeting 10+ GW renewable capacity by 2030.
PAT margin for FY27 expected to be lower than previous guidance (16%-18%) due to seasonality and stabilization, but to recover in FY28.
Focus on expanding IPP and CPP segments, battery storage, green hydrogen, floating solar, offshore wind, and energy trading.
Management expects continued growth in renewable energy demand and project pipeline.
